Is the movie a haunting in Connecticut a true story?
“The Haunting in Connecticut” isn’t based on just any old true story. No, it’s based on “the true story.” That would be the case of the Snedeker family, who in the 1970s moved into a ghost-infested house in Southington, Conn., and had no end of distress.
Is The Haunting in Connecticut connected to a haunting in Connecticut 2?
According to screenwriter David Coggeshall, this movie was never intended to be any kind of sequel to The Haunting in Connecticut (2009) and they only became “related” when Gold Circle, the studio behind both movies, decided they wanted to try and capitalize on the success of the first movie.
What town is the haunting of CT in?
Southington, Connecticut
The 2009 psychological horror film “The Haunting in Connecticut” tells the story of the Snedeker family, who in 1986 rented an old house in Southington, Connecticut. Allen and Carmen Snedeker moved in with their daughter and three young sons.
What happened to the family in The Haunting in Connecticut?
The Snedeker family lived in the house for two years after it was exorcised, then moved to Tennessee. The children are grown now with children of their own, and Carmen Reed (nee Snedeker) is now a “spiritual advisor.” She also has plans of writing another book based on the experience with John Zaffis.
What is the story behind the haunting of Connecticut?
The film is alleged to be about Carmen Snedeker and her family, though Ray Garton, author of In a Dark Place: The Story of a True Haunting (1992), has publicly distanced himself from the accuracy of the events he depicted in the book….
